Clemson Real Madrid Launch Elite Sports Management Program

Education · 10/05/2024

Clemson Real Madrid Launch Elite Sports Management Program

Clemson University and Real Madrid Graduate School – Universidad Europea are launching a Sports Management study abroad program in Fall 2025. This collaborative program leverages the strengths of both institutions, offering an international curriculum, practical industry experience, and unique 'Real Madrid Experience' activities. The program aims to cultivate sports management professionals with a global perspective and practical skills, enhancing their career prospects. Graduates boast a 92% employment rate and an average starting salary significantly higher than similar programs.

Linkedin Rankings Aim to Enhance Graduate Employability

Education · 08/13/2025

Linkedin Rankings Aim to Enhance Graduate Employability

LinkedIn released its "Top Universities" list, focusing on higher education institutions' performance in enhancing students' career readiness. The list uses metrics like graduate employment rates as core indicators, providing a new perspective on measuring the return on investment in higher education. This aims to offer students more valuable and data-driven insights when choosing a university. The ranking highlights institutions that effectively prepare their graduates for successful careers, making it a useful tool for prospective students and their families.
